Prime Minister Narendra Modi is associating with the best gamers in India on several issues related to the gaming industry. In a 32-minute video shared on the prime minister’s YouTube channel, gamers Tirth Mehta, Payal Dhare, Animesh Agarwal, Anshu Bisht, Naman Mathur, Mithilesh Patankar, and Ganesh Gangadhar can be seen locked in an ingenuous conversation.
During the interaction, gamer Animesh Agarwal said that the government ought to perceive esports and gaming as standard wear. “It is skill-based gaming and does not include betting. Once it is built up and caught on by all government bodies, counting those included in money-related exchanges, it will be truly advantageous. Like you said, the industry does not require a direction.
We ought to let it develop unreservedly. With a small thrust, the industry will be ready,” he said. PrimeServ replied, It (esports and gaming) does not require any control. It must stay free, as if at that point it will boom.” Prime Minister Narendra Modi tries his hand at gaming amid his interaction with India’s best gamers. PM Modi inquired about the gamer’s display in the interaction. Tirth Mehta, the gamer from Kutch in Gujarat, said, People feel that we play recreations for passing time. We play recreations that are truly distinctive from the others, but individuals think they are as simple as ludo. But that’s not genuine. We play complex recreations, such as chess, that require mental and physical skills. On what are the dos and don’ts, Anshu Bisht said, If somebody needs to accomplish the level of gamer victory as me, I exhort them to take after my life way. I took after my enthusiasm for gaming in college and began my work. I didn’t desert other angles of my life to exclusively center on gaming.” Payal Dhar, the female gamer in the interaction, said, There are two categories in gaming and esports. In eSports, you compete against each other. In substance creation, we make intelligent recordings around gaming that individuals truly enjoy.” Towards the conclusion of the interaction, PM Modi wore a virtual headset and attempted his hands at gaming.
